Why Install Antivirus Software?

Antivirus software is designed to detect, prevent, and remove malware, including viruses, worms, trojans, spyware, adware, and ransomware. These malicious programs can cause a variety of problems, ranging from slowing down your computer to stealing your personal data or demanding ransom in exchange for restoring access to your files. By installing antivirus software, you significantly reduce the risk of your computer becoming infected, thereby safeguarding your privacy and the integrity of your data.

Choosing the Right Antivirus Software

The market is flooded with antivirus software options, each offering varying levels of protection, features, and user experience. When choosing an antivirus program, consider the following factors:

  1. Effectiveness: Look for software that has high detection rates and can effectively remove malware.
  2. Compatibility: Ensure the software is compatible with your operating system (Windows, macOS, Android, iOS, etc.).
  3. Features: Decide on the features you need, such as firewall protection, phishing protection, password management, and VPN.
  4. User Reviews and Ratings: Check for reviews from independent testing labs and user feedback to gauge the software’s performance and usability.
  5. Cost: Antivirus software can range from free to several hundred dollars per year, depending on the features and number of devices covered.

Installing Antivirus Software

Once you’ve selected your antivirus software, follow these steps to install it:

  1. Download the Software: Go to the official website of the antivirus software provider and download the installation package. Be cautious of fake or malicious websites.
  2. Run the Installer: Execute the downloaded file and follow the on-screen instructions. You may be asked to choose between a full installation or a custom installation, where you can select specific components.
  3. Activate the Software: If you’ve purchased a license, enter your activation key when prompted. For free versions, this step may not be required.
  4. Initial Scan: After installation, it’s a good practice to run a full scan of your computer to detect and remove any existing malware.

Updating Antivirus Software

Keeping your antivirus software updated is crucial for maintaining its effectiveness against new and evolving threats. Updates often include:

  1. Signature Updates: These updates add new virus definitions to the software’s database, allowing it to recognize and combat newly discovered malware.
  2. Program Updates: These updates improve the software itself, fixing bugs, enhancing performance, and sometimes adding new features.

To update your antivirus software:

  1. Automatic Updates: Most antivirus software is set to update automatically by default. Ensure this feature is enabled in the software’s settings.
  2. Manual Updates: If automatic updates are not enabled, you can usually find an "Update" button within the software’s interface. Clicking this will initiate a manual update check.

Best Practices

  • Regular Scans: Schedule regular scans (at least once a week) to ensure your computer remains malware-free.
  • Real-Time Protection: Enable real-time protection to scan files, emails, and websites as you access them.
  • Safe Browsing: Always be cautious when browsing the internet, avoiding suspicious links and downloads.
  • Password Security: Use strong, unique passwords and consider enabling two-factor authentication where possible.
